Arlesey is a large, growing village just North of the Beds/Herts border, surrounded by countryside yet within easy reach of the A507 and A1(M). The village offers a range of local shopping, pubs and food outlets and significantly a Mainline Railway station with direct travel to London St. Pancras in under 40 minutes. Dating back as long as the 1086 Domesday Book, there is a broad range of home styles and building eras - something for everyone! Gothic Mede Academy provides Primary education in the middle of the village, with numerous Secondary options including Etonbury Academy on the Arlesey/Stotfold border. Further facilities and shopping are available within a few miles in the larger towns of Letchworth Garden City and Hitchin to the South.
